Borgatm5 Catches Johan Bluffing

Level 8 : Blinds 400/800, 800 ante

Borgatm5 opened to 2,000 from middle position, then called after Johan to his left three-bet to 6,200.

On a board of 451035, Johan bet 4,100, fired a second barrel of 11,300 and a third barrel of 35,000.

Borgatm5 check-called on the flop and on the turn, then went deep into the tank on the river. He eventually made the call with 99 and caught Johan bluffing with AK.

Short Stack Doubles Through Mamalepot

Level 8 : Blinds 400/800, 800 ante

Claude Mamalepot raised to 1,700 from the cutoff, the small blind three-bet to 4,500 and Mamalepot hesitated but made the call.

Small blind: A9 All in
Claude Mamalepot: 54

The player in the small blind kept the lead all the way through a board of 8107Q5 and he doubled up.

Angeletti Doubles Up

Level 7 : Blinds 300/600, 600 ante

The under-the-gun player opened to 1,200, then Lorenzo Angeletti moved all-in for 14,500 from two seats over. Mathieu Choffardet in middle position went into the tank and folded, but the under-the-gun player called.

Lorenzo Angeletti: AK All in
Under-the-gun player: 88

Angeletti was lucky enough to hit top pair on 2A576 to secure a double up. Choffardet said that he folded tens.

Eugen Takes A Small One

Level 7 : Blinds 300/600, 600 ante

"Eugen" on the button opened to 1,200, and Leo Worthington-Leese defended from the big blind.

The dealer fanned a flop of 9A8 where Eugen continued for 1,000. Worthington-Leese check-called.

Eugen fired a second barrel of 3,000 on the 2 turn. Worthington-Leese stared at the board for a few seconds before folding.

Flush for Nashar

Level 7 : Blinds 300/600, 600 ante

Three-way on a flop of QJ7, Raul on the button bet 2,500. He was called by Hassan Nashar in the small blind, while the big blind folded.

Raul fired a second barrel of 2,500 on the 10 turn, but Nashar didn't back down and called.

The 6 completed the board and Nashar led out for 10,000. Raul eventually made the call with AK for a straight, but ran into Nashar's flush with K9.

Supper Doubles Through Gogniat

Level 6 : Blinds 300/500, 500 ante

After Sebastian Supper on the button moved all-in for 16,300, Thierry Gogniat in the cutoff went into the tank and eventually made the call.

Sebastian Supper: AQ All in
Thierry Gogniat: 66

Supper stood up after the dealer fanned a flop of 548, but he was immediately back at his seat thanks to the A turn.

The 3 completed the board and he doubled up.
